Thereby, we can stop springboot logging in console and separate log file.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S. 2. 10 How to disable debug and info logs in Spring Boot test? In Spring Boot, Logback is the default logging framework, just add spring-boot-starter-web, it will pull in the logback dependencies. I find it still a bit strange that disabling in log4j's properties is not enough to suppress Hibernate's log messages, but this is Java EE, I shouldn't keep my hopes that high, should I? You can use ExchangeFilterFunction. I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? The solution is simple. And if you still can't disable show_sql try something like this. The application properties and log back is used to enable and disable the console logging in spring boot application. Spring Boot provides a ready to use logging mechanism within the spring-boot-starter-logging dependency. Asking for help, clarification, or responding to other answers. Find centralized, trusted content and collaborate around the technologies you use most. Copyright 2022 it-qa.com | All rights reserved. @XaviLpez Thanks, I had actually a similar one in my Spring application context, and setting it there solved the problem. What kind of logging is available in Spring Boot? In this example, we have learned the many ways we can configure the logging of our Spring Boot application. Should we burninate the [variations] tag? The dependecny is not found. Is there any to disable console output? Should we burninate the [variations] tag? }, P.S. Logging Spring Boot has no mandatory logging dependency, except for the Commons Logging API, which is typically provided by Spring Framework's spring-jcl module. The spring boot supports enable and disable console log, info and debug messages should be disabled in console logging and redirected to a log file. Spring Boot supports all logger levels such as "TRACE", "DEBUG", "INFO", "WARN", "ERROR", "FATAL", "OFF". By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. 3. What is a good way to make an abstract board game truly alien? Then, we will include the dependency for Log4j 2 and configure it using the YAML format. What is the effect of cycling on weight loss? Provides access to the response status and headers, and also methods to consume the response body. First, we will disable it so our logs won't be handled by Logback. Either remove Logback or the competing implementation Add the below lines at the end of your application specific appenders are added. Connect and share knowledge within a single location that is structured and easy to search. Why is Spring Boot loading all xml files when I only specify one? I wanted to remove this page does anyone have any idea how to do this? In C, why limit || and && to evaluate to booleans? Asking for help, clarification, or responding to other answers. Is there a way to make trades similar/identical to a university endowment manager to copy them? However, if the configuration file allows it, you can set the level of loggers on the command line via a Java system property. What exactly makes a black hole STAY a black hole? Use log-level OFF, ERROR, WARN, DEBUG, in addition to a log4j.properties or log4j.xml file you will need all three of these entries in your maven pom.xml adding the log4j-acl artifact instantly fixed the problem for me. Spring Boots default configurations provides a support for the use of Java Util Logging, Log4j2, and Logback. Connect and share knowledge within a single location that is structured and easy to search.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. To use Logback, you need to include it and spring-jcl on the classpath. Then I read in the same doc, The logging system is initialized early in the application lifecycle and as such logging properties will not be found in property files loaded via @PropertySource annotations", "Since logging is initialized before the ApplicationContext is created, it isnt possible to control logging from @PropertySources in Spring @Configuration files". Make a wide rectangle out of T-Pipes without loops. Here, well see different ways to disable the spring boot console log. Default Logging With No Configurations Spring boot allows us to see the logs in the console even if we do not provide any specific configuration for it. How do I fix Java build path errors in eclipse? If you are using starter dependencies, Logback is by default used for logging. Connect and share knowledge within a single location that is structured and easy to search. Spring additionally provides some custom logback's Converter implementations to customize output, for example Spring binds the convention-word '%clr' to ColorConverter which returns output with the ANSI color codes. What is the function of in ? 1.3 Turn off the Spring banner. Voila! The simplest way to do that is through the starters, which all depend on spring-boot-starter-logging . Thereby, we can stop springboot logging in console and separate log file. How to check Webclient responses in Spring Boot? Does activating the pump in a vacuum chamber produce movement of the air inside? We can change the patterns, disable logging, enable more logging information, pretty print the logging information, send the logging output to a file, and many more. Spring Boot provides a ready to use logging mechanism within the spring-boot-starter-logging dependency. Configuring lo4j2 logging with Tomcat embedded in a Spring Boot web app Why does spring-boot-starter-jetty depend on tomcat-embed-el? rev2022.11.3.43005. Please be sure to answer the question. To stop the console logging, use the no logging console global configuration command (highly recommended for routers that are not usually accessed through the console port) or you might want to limit the amount of messages sent to the console with the logging console level configuration command (for example, logging . Application.properties file. The only required dependency for logging using Spring Boot is Apache Commons Logging. Should we burninate the [variations] tag? Yes, because if you don't exclude "spring-boot-starter-logging" from "spring-boot-starter" specifically it will likely still find a way to get into your jars from some other Spring starter - ArturT Jan 30, 2021 at 2:57 Add a comment 13 For gradle, A log file named as spring.log will be created in concretepage/logs relative to root directory of the project. Designates informational messages that highlight the progress of the application at coarse-grained level. This means that root logger has WARN level. Add the below lines at the end of your application specific appenders are added. How to disable debug and info logs in Spring Boot test?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. According to spring boot doc, you need provide your own logging config file, logging.file will only additional log to file, here is the link: http://docs.spring.io/spring-boot/docs/current/reference/html/howto-logging.html.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Then I read in the same doc We are working on a basic Spring Boot 2.2.6 app with the Web dependency. Asking for help, clarification, or responding to other answers. How to enable and disable console logging in Spring Boot? Reason for use of accusative in this phrase? I tried to redirect the log output only to a file, but Spring Boot stills logs in console. . 1)By using AnnotationConfigApplicationContext: @SpringBootApplication Spring boot embedded tomcat logs; How to make java.util.logging send logs to Logback? Maven Dependencies (the relevant ones for my doubt): In application.properties you can add logging.level. LoggerFactory is not a Logback LoggerContext but Logback is on the classpath. 10. How to ouput the log of Apache Mina SSHD? 76.1 Configure Logback for logging. For those users who tried everything proposed and still saw the sql logs: If you annotated your test with @DataJpaTest, set the (not so obvious) showSql-field inside to false. *) from the right corner of the search input. spring: main: banner-mode: off logging: pattern: console: Use the setup:config:set command to disable debug logging for the current mode. Is there a recommended way to reach this via maven? Your approach would disable even the printing of logs that one sees while an application starts. To learn more, see our tips on writing great answers. Why is SQL Server setup recommending MAXDOP 8 here? . For me this worked:
Engineering Materials Pdf Notes, Distinction First Class Second Class Percentage, Thermal Imaging App For Android, Why Can T I Upgrade My Gear In Minecraft, Advantages Of Special Education Pdf, Ground Bratwurst Sausage Recipes,